|
Welcome.
|
|
|
|
|
I want to create a portal in asp.net as a part of my BE engineering project.
I am in the initial stages of documentation.
One of the modules creating personalized pages for each member with blog facility, personal details and photo gallery. A blog will be created for each user in the portal and they can post articles and stuff on their blog and other members can view their profile and the blog....
I wanna information on that on which asp.net technology can be used and whether it is possible or not.. I am sure it can be done but just need information on the same.
Please let me know....
Thanks
|
|
|
|
|
|
i have already checked that .
its a source code for creating a blog.
i wanna know if i can create a blog for each user in my site.
As in when a user registers in the portal. A blog should be created in his account automatically. ie a personalized blog for each member.
|
|
|
|
|
lionelcyril wrote: As in when a user registers in the portal. A blog should be created in his account automatically. ie a personalized blog for each member.
Oh.. I got your point.
You can have a look into following .NET Open Source Blogging Project
BlogEngine.NET
See the list of Features,
BlogEngine.NET Features
|
|
|
|
|
Still awaiting some favorable replies....
i wanna some rough technical ideas on how to achieve this. Each member can have his own blog in a portal.
|
|
|
|
|
dear all,
i tried to display a falsh object in my asp .net page. but it does not work. what is the correct way for this. can i use addRotator for this...
|
|
|
|
|
This has nothing to do with ASP.NET. Use object[^] HTML element to embed objects to a page.
|
|
|
|
|
|
I m creating a small report in asp.net 1.1
In my report i have two columns fix and resting will be created dynamically.
e.g
------------------------------------------------------------
DataColumn1 | DataColumn2 | ........ | ........ | ........ |
------------------------------------------------------------
01/01/2009 |Qty: | | | |
|Value: | | | |
02/01/2009 |Qty: | | | |
|Value: |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
| | | | |
------------------------------------------------------------
------------------------------------------------------------
I have selected datagrid for this.
but i dont know how i can achieve this
any suggestion??
One person's data is another person's program.
--J.Walia
|
|
|
|
|
Use template column and put another data grid inside that. Handle the row binding event, find the inner data grid and bind it.
|
|
|
|
|
thanks bro
i used rowspan property
One person's data is another person's program.
--J.Walia
|
|
|
|
|
Hi this is the scenario:
The users of my site can get a link with a refer code (query string) to promote their products on their blogs or sites.
I want to track those codes so if a order is created I can give points to refer users as a kind of omission.
The problem is before visitor creates an order he/she needs to log in or even register to the site.
So I'm looking for a way to trap that code once the visitor enter to my site and don't loose it when he\she log in with a new session .
I was thinking to store that code in the session or profile but it will change once the visitor logs in.
In brief I need to capture a refer query string value once the visitor came to mi site, store it and if he/she log in and create an order I can know whow refer him/her.
I'm using asp.net 3.5.
I'm going to try some things but I would like to know if you can suggest me something.
Thanks
La realidad no es más que impulsos eléctricos del cerebro - Morpheus
|
|
|
|
|
1 - You get a request with the code in URL as query string.
2 - Keep that in a session.
3 - When user logs in, check this session's value. If session has value, take the code and proceed.
machocr wrote: I was thinking to store that code in the session or profile but it will change once the visitor logs in.
I didn't understood this. How come a value stored in session changes when user logs in?
|
|
|
|
|
Thanks,
"I didn't understood this. How come a value stored in session changes when user logs in?"
yep that's right for some reason I thought so
La realidad no es más que impulsos eléctricos del cerebro - Morpheus
|
|
|
|
|
Hello
I have an ImageMap created using YDreams ImageMapDemo 2.0. I'm using this control for the rollover image effect with circle and polygons hotspots. My issue is I can't seem to figure out how to write the correct C# code for each hotspot. I am able to get one hotspot to have the rollover effect but not the other 4. Can someone please help me out with the code behind. I am very very new with C#. Anyone's help would be much appreciated. Been banging my head for 2 months.
Thanks in advanced
Dale
Form code
<%@ Page Language="C#" AutoEventWireup="true" CodeFile="Default2.aspx.cs" Inherits="Default2" %>
<%@ Register Assembly="YDreams.Web.UI.WebControls" Namespace="YDreams.Web.UI.WebControls"
TagPrefix="ydreams"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head runat="server">
<title></title>
<script type="text/javascript">
function pageLoad() {
}
</script>
</head>
<body>
<form id="form1" runat="server">
<div>
<asp:ScriptManager ID="ScriptManager1" runat="server" />
</div>
<div>
<ydreams:ImageMap ID="ImageMap1" ImageUrl="methodology_circle_green.gif" OnClick="ImageMap1_Click" runat="server">
<ydreams:CircleHotSpot CenterX="210" CenterY="45" Description="Click to test post back..."
HotSpotMode="Navigate" Radius="41" ToolTip="Post back" Id="AssessCircle" />
<ydreams:CircleHotSpot CenterX="310" CenterY="120" Description="Click to test post back..."
HotSpotMode="Navigate" Radius="41" ToolTip="Post back" Id="AnalyzeCircle" />
<ydreams:CircleHotSpot CenterX="270" CenterY="240" Description="Click to test post back..."
HotSpotMode="Navigate" Radius="41" ToolTip="Post back" Id="ArchitectCircle" />
<ydreams:CircleHotSpot CenterX="145" CenterY="240" Description="Click to test post back..."
HotSpotMode="Navigate" Radius="41" ToolTip="Post back" Id="AssembleCircle" />
<ydreams:CircleHotSpot CenterX="103" CenterY="120" Description="Click to test post back..."
HotSpotMode="Navigate" Radius="41" ToolTip="Post back" Id="AssimilateCircle" />
</ydreams:ImageMap>
<asp:Label ID="Label1" runat="server" Text=""></asp:Label>
</div>
</form>
</body>
</html>
C# Code Behind
using System;
using System.Data;
using System.Configuration;
using System.Web;
using System.Web.Security;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.WebControls.WebParts;
using System.Web.UI.HtmlControls;
using System.Text;
public partial class Default2 :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
YDreams.Web.UI.WebControls.HotSpot AssessCircle = new YDreams.Web.UI.WebControls.CircleHotSpot(210, 45, 41);
{
ImageMap1.HotSpots.Add(AssessCircle);
{
YDreams.Web.UI.WebControls.CircleHotSpot circleHotSpot = (YDreams.Web.UI.WebControls.CircleHotSpot)this.ImageMap1.HotSpots["AssessCircle"];
{
circleHotSpot.Attributes.Add("onMouseOver", "javascript:DisplayImage(image2);");
circleHotSpot.Attributes.Add("onMouseOut", "javascript:DisplayImage(image1);");
}
string script = @"
var image1 = new Image(413, 285);
image1.src = 'methodology_circle_green.gif';
var image2 = new Image(413, 285);
image2.src = 'methodology_circle_blue_assess.gif';
function DisplayImage(image) {
var theImage = document.images['ImageMap1'];
if (!theImage) {
theImage = document.getElementById('ImageMap1');
}
theImage.src = image.src;
return true;
}
";
this.ClientScript.RegisterClientScriptBlock(this.GetType(), "DisplayImage", script, true);
}
}
YDreams.Web.UI.WebControls.HotSpot AnalyzeCircle = new YDreams.Web.UI.WebControls.CircleHotSpot(310, 120, 41);
{
ImageMap1.HotSpots.Add(AnalyzeCircle);
{
YDreams.Web.UI.WebControls.CircleHotSpot circleHotSpot = (YDreams.Web.UI.WebControls.CircleHotSpot)this.ImageMap1.HotSpots["AnalyzeCircle"];
{
circleHotSpot.Attributes.Add("onMouseOver", "javascript:DisplayImage(image2);");
circleHotSpot.Attributes.Add("onMouseOut", "javascript:DisplayImage(image1);");
}
string script = @"
var image1 = new Image(413, 285);
image1.src = 'methodology_circle_green.gif';
var image2 = new Image(413, 285);
image2.src = 'methodology_circle_blue_analyze.gif';
function DisplayImage(image) {
var theImage = document.images['ImageMap1'];
if (!theImage) {
theImage = document.getElementById('ImageMap1');
}
theImage.src = image.src;
return true;
}
";
this.ClientScript.RegisterClientScriptBlock(this.GetType(), "DisplayImage", script, true);
}
}
}
protected void ImageMap1_Click(object sender, YDreams.Web.UI.WebControls.ImageMapClickEventArgs args)
{
YDreams.Web.UI.WebControls.HotSpot hotSpot = args.HotSpot;
int x = args.X;
int y = args.Y;
this.Label1.Text = string.Format("Clicked on hot spot \"{0}\" at image coordinates ({1}, {2})", hotSpot.Id, x, y);
}
protected void Button1_Click(object sender, EventArgs e)
{
this.Label1.Text = string.Empty;
}
}
modified on Friday, July 31, 2009 8:20 PM
|
|
|
|
|
dmgroup1984 wrote: I am very very new with C+. Anyone's help would be much appreciated. Been banging my head for 2 months.
erm... if you're so new to C# ( there is no such thing as C+ ), why are you taking on this task ?
Odds are that most people don't even know the product you're using. Don't they have a support forum ?
Christian Graus
Driven to the arms of OSX by Vista.
Read my blog to find out how I've worked around bugs in Microsoft tools and frameworks.
|
|
|
|
|
YDreams does have a support forum for this control but it is on this site and no one seems to look at it. I found YDreams Imagemap 2.0 on the Code Project website( Here )and was hoping someone has used this control and if they could help me out with the issue I'm having.
|
|
|
|
|
It's unlikely. But, if the article is orphaned, then perhaps it's your best bet. I would be looking for something else to use, or googling to see if it's also posted elsewhere and supported there.
Christian Graus
Driven to the arms of OSX by Vista.
Read my blog to find out how I've worked around bugs in Microsoft tools and frameworks.
|
|
|
|
|
hello
i have to create a web services in .net 2.0 php consume the services web.
can someone help me with guide, what type data are comun used to transport the data.
thanks,
|
|
|
|
|
I would assume so long as you don't send .NET classes, if you just send plain data like text and numbers, you should be fine.
Even if you sent a class, it's just a matter of working out how to parse it from the XML.
Christian Graus
Driven to the arms of OSX by Vista.
Read my blog to find out how I've worked around bugs in Microsoft tools and frameworks.
|
|
|
|
|
thanks Christian
1. when i need to send data (a list of data repetitive)
house type B/.
villa nueva casa 5000.00
bethania apartamento 20000.00
wha type of data you recommend to transport from asp net2.0 webservice to php
2. when i need to send data (a list of data)
name lastname year
miguel sam 1980
wha type of data you recomend to transport from asp net2.0 webservice to php
thanks for the time
regards
|
|
|
|
|
|
Here is some tips for adding dynamic control.
. You have to create all the control before Page_Load() , Preferably on Page_PreInit() . Because if we create any dynamic control after Page_load() , The control will not maintain, ViewState and Postback data . Because, View State and Post back Load just before Page_load. So, if we create any control after postback, it will not able to get the view state and postback data.
Let me know if you have any problem.
Hope this information will help you
|
|
|
|
|
I know that
But I do not care about viewstate or Postback, all controls that should talk to server are in main page, not in update panel, only thing that do not work as wanted is ScriptManagers OnNavigate event. It fires too late. I need that event to handle f5, back and forward.
If controls are added as fallows:
protected void mi1_click(object sender, EventArgs e)
{
test();
}
all is ok
But in this case:
public void OnNavigateHistory(object sender, HistoryEventArgs e)
{
test();
}
it will not work
void test()
{
//This line works fine in both cases. It sets couple of properties, as label texts and session variables.
set_title("Test title");
//Instead of button I need my usercontrol, but even button will not show up.
Button btn = new Button();
btn.Text = "I bitīt matos!!!!!!!!!!!";
PHolder.Controls.Clear();
PHolder.Controls.Add(btn);
sm.AddHistoryPoint("aa", "bb");
}
It`s nothing to wory before something happen and when it happents it`s alredy to late to wory!
modified on Friday, July 31, 2009 3:15 PM
|
|
|
|